What Lecithin Is and Where It Comes From
Lecithin is a general term for a group of fatty substances essential to all living cells. These compounds are a mixture of phospholipids, specialized fats that form the structural basis of cell membranes. Phospholipids are crucial for maintaining cellular integrity and function.
The most abundant component of lecithin is phosphatidylcholine, the primary source of the nutrient choline in the diet. Choline is a vitamin-like compound that plays a role in nerve signaling and various metabolic processes. Commercially, lecithin is most commonly extracted from sources like soybeans, sunflower seeds, and egg yolks.
Supplemental lecithin is available in granules, powders, and capsules, but it is also naturally present in whole foods. Dietary sources include organ meats, red meat, seafood, and certain cooked green vegetables. The composition varies depending on its source, with most commercial products derived from soy or sunflower oil.
The Theoretical Link to Fat Metabolism
The belief that lecithin promotes weight loss stems from its powerful function as an emulsifier. As an emulsifier, lecithin has the ability to suspend fats and oils in water, preventing separation. This property is widely used in food manufacturing to keep ingredients smoothly blended, such as in chocolate and ice cream.
The theory suggests this same emulsifying action works within the body to break down dietary fats into smaller particles. These smaller fat globules are hypothesized to be easier for digestive enzymes to process and transport, thereby preventing fat accumulation. By aiding in the digestion and transport of fats, lecithin is theorized to support more rapid lipid metabolism.
Furthermore, the choline found within lecithin supports liver function, which is central to fat processing. Choline is involved in transporting fats away from the liver, helping prevent fat deposits. This theoretical mechanism suggests that lecithin could indirectly aid weight management by optimizing the body’s ability to handle and metabolize fat.
Evaluating the Scientific Evidence for Weight Management
Despite the compelling theoretical mechanisms, scientific studies have generally failed to demonstrate that lecithin supplementation causes direct, significant weight loss in healthy people. The current clinical evidence does not support using lecithin as an effective weight-loss aid. Emulsification of fats in the digestive tract does not automatically translate into a reduction in overall body fat or body weight.
While lecithin contains phosphatidylcholine, which breaks down into choline, the impact on body composition is not clearly established. One small 2014 study observed that choline supplementation reduced body mass in female athletes undergoing rapid weight loss, but this finding has not been widely replicated. The effects seen in this select group cannot be generalized to the average person seeking weight reduction.
Lecithin’s components have documented benefits for lipid health, such as lowering levels of low-density lipoprotein (LDL) cholesterol. This effect on cholesterol transport highlights its role in metabolism but is distinct from causing measurable body weight loss. The theoretical advantage of improved fat processing often does not result in the sustained calorie deficit necessary for actual weight reduction.
Preclinical research in animal models has produced mixed results, with some studies showing that the effect of soy lecithin on body fat depends entirely on the administered dose. Relying on lecithin to overcome a caloric surplus is not supported by conclusive human clinical trials. The overall consensus is that while lecithin is involved in lipid metabolism, it is not a direct path to weight loss.
Safe Consumption and Practical Integration
Lecithin is generally recognized as safe for consumption and is well-tolerated when taken in typical supplemental dosages. Doses used in studies have ranged up to 30 grams daily for a few weeks, though there is no set recommended daily intake. Supplements are available in granular form, which can be sprinkled onto food, or as soft-gel capsules.
Potential side effects are usually mild and related to the digestive system, including temporary issues such as stomach pain, nausea, or a feeling of fullness. Individuals with allergies to soy or eggs should exercise caution, as many lecithin supplements are derived from these sources. Sunflower lecithin is a common alternative for those avoiding soy-based products.
Instead of viewing lecithin supplements as a weight-loss solution, it is more practical to focus on consuming a balanced diet rich in natural sources of the compound. Incorporating foods like eggs, legumes, and lean meats provides lecithin along with other beneficial nutrients. While supplementation is safe, it should support overall metabolic health rather than serve as a primary tool for shedding pounds.
